Understand the fundamental principles and requirements of environmental technology systems Aim: This knowledge unit provides learning in the fundamental working principles along with regulatory requirement relating to renewable energy. Be able to distinguish the potential type of building features that will meet the requirements to install renewable energy water conservation along with typical advantages and disadvantages. Learning outcome 1. Know the fundamental working principles of micro-renewable energy and water conservation technologies 1.1 Identify the fundamental working principles for each of the followingheat producing micro-renewable energy technologies:solar thermal (hot water)ground source heat pumpair source heat pumpbiomass1.2 Identify the fundamental working principles for each of the following electricity producing micro-renewable energy technologies:solar photovoltaicmicro-windmicro-hydro1.3 Identify the fundamental working principles of the following cogeneration technologies:micro-combined heat and power (heat-led)1.4 Identify the fundamental working principles for each of the following water conservation technologies:rainwater harvestinggreywater re-use.2. Know the fundamental requirements of building location/building features for the potential to install micro-renewable energy and water conservation systems to exist
2.1 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a solar water heating system to exist2.2 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a solar photovoltaic system to exist2.3 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a ground source heat pump system to exist2.4 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install an air source heat pump system to exist2.5 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a biomass system to exist2.6 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a micro wind system to exist2.7 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a micro hydro system to exist2.8 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a micro-combined heat and power (heat led) system to exist2.9 Clarify the fundamental requirements for the potential to install a rain water harvesting/greywater re-use system to exist. 3. Know the fundamental regulatory requirements relating to microrenewable energy and water conservation technologies 3.1 Confirm what would be typically classified as ‘permitted development’ under town and country planning (environmental impact) regulations in relation to the deployment of the following technologies:solar thermal (hot water)solar photovoltaicground source heat pumpair source heat pumpmicro-windbiomassmicro-hydromicro-combined heat and power (heat-led)rainwater harvestinggreywater re-use3.2 Confirm which sections of the current building regulations/building standards apply in relation to the deployment of the following solar thermal (hot water)solar photovoltaticground source heat pumpair source heat pumpmicro-windbiomassmicro-hydromicro-combined heat and power (heat-led)rainwater harvestinggreywater re-use. 4. Know the typical advantages and disadvantages associated with micro-renewable energy and water conservation technologies4.1 Identify typical advantages associated with each of the following technologies:solar thermal (hot water)solar photovoltaicground source heat pumpair source heat pumpmicro-windbiomassmicro-hydromicro-combined heat and power (heat-led)rainwater harvestinggreywater re-use4.2 Identify typical disadvantages associated with each of the following technologies:solar thermal (hot water)solar photovoltaicground source heat pumpair source heat pumpmicro-windbiomassmicro-hydromicro-combined heat and power (heat-led)rainwater harvestinggreywater re-use.
